> I am a castor newbie but you might want to try this
> 
> Mapping m = new Mapping();
>               InputStream i =
>
getClass().getClassLoader().getResourceAsStream("s");
>               if(i==null)
>                       System.out.println("ClassLoader issues!")
>               m.loadMapping(new InputSource(i));
> 
> 
> If this does not work, there could be some class
> loader issues.
> Try experimenting with keeping the mapping at the
> top
> level instead of a jar and other variations.
> hope this helps.
